Future Trends in rCB Refining Technology

🔬

Ultra-Fine Milling

Modern refining plants are moving beyond simple pyrolysis. The trend is toward D90 < 10μm particle size distribution, allowing rCB to compete directly with semi-reinforcing grades like N660 and N774.

🤖

AI-Driven Automation

Integration of IoT and AI for real-time monitoring of temperature and pressure ensures consistent quality, reducing the "batch-to-batch" variability that previously hindered rCB adoption.

🌱

De-ashing Technology

Advanced chemical and physical de-ashing processes are being developed to reduce the inorganic content (ash) from 15% down to below 5%, significantly improving the reinforcing properties in rubber compounds.

Global Procurement & Localized Applications

Procurement demands for Recovered Carbon Black Refining Plants are no longer limited to waste management companies. We are seeing high demand from:

  • Tire Manufacturers: Seeking to close the loop on their own waste streams.
  • Chemical Conglomerates: Diversifying their portfolio with sustainable additives.
  • Government Infrastructure Projects: Utilizing rCB in asphalt and construction materials for "Green City" initiatives.

In regions like Europe (Germany, Poland), the focus is on high-purity rCB for automotive parts. In Southeast Asia and India, the demand is driven by the massive volume of waste tires and the need for cost-effective fillers in the footwear and conveyor belt industries.

Typical Application Scenarios:

• Rubber Industry: Tires, seals, hoses, and anti-vibration parts.
• Plastics: Masterbatches for film, pipe, and automotive plastics.
• Coatings & Inks: Pigment for industrial paints and printing inks.
• Infrastructure: Modified bitumen for road construction.
